Tips on Brushing Your Canine for Canine Parents in Moncton NB




Routine grooming with a brush or comb will help keep your fur baby’s hair in good condition by getting rid of dirt, spreading natural oils across her coat, avoiding tangles and maintaining her skin tidy and irritant-free.

Plus, grooming time is a great time to check for fleas and flea dirt– those little black specks that indicate your fur baby is playing host to a flea household.

Learn more about, brushing you dogs or read listed below.

The way you brush your pet and how frequently will mostly depend on his or her coat type.

Smooth, Short Coats: If your canine has a smooth, short coat (like that of a Chihuahua, Boxer or Basset Hound), you just need to brush as soon as a week. Use a rubber brush to loosen up dead skin and dirt and follow with bristle brush to remove dead hair. Polish your low-maintenance pooch with a chamois cloth and she’s all set to shine!

Brief, Thick Fur: If your canine has short, thick fur that’s inclined to matting, like that of a retriever, brushing once a week is fine. Choose a slicker brush to remove tangles and catch dead hair with a bristle brush. Do not forget to brush her tail!

Long, Silky Coats: If your canine has a long, elegant coat, like that of a Yorkshire terrier, she’ll need daily looking after. Every day you’ll require to eliminate tangles with a slicker brush. Next, brush her coat with a bristle brush. If you have a long-haired pet with a coat like a collie’s or an Afghan hound’s, follow the actions above, however also be sure to comb through the fur and trim the hair around the feet.

Long Hair That’s Frequently Matted: For long-haired pooches, it’s a great concept to establish a day-to-day grooming regular to remove tangles and prevent mats. Carefully tease out tangles with a slicker brush, and after that brush your pet with a bristle brush. If matting is especially dense, you might try clipping the hair, making sure not to come near the skin.

Knowing When to See the Veterinarion in Moncton NB

You need to arrange a visit with your veterinarian right after you discover any abnormalities in your pet’s skin or hair, or if your pet starts to scratch, lick, or bite parts of his fur exceedingly.

Your veterinarian might undertake diagnostic tests to identify the source of the symptoms of the canine, including a skin biopsy, ringworm testing, tiny hair and skin checks for parasites or infection, and blood tests to examine the basic health of the pet dog.

Ways to Protect Against Dental Concerns in Dogs

Give your pooch treats that are specifically developed to keep canine teeth healthy, and ask your veterinarian about a specifically formulated dry food that can slow down the formation of plaque and tartar.

Chew toys are likewise an excellent way to please your dog’s natural desire to munch while making his or her teeth strong. Munching on a chew toy can assist massage the gums and keep teeth tidy by scraping away soft tartar, plus it likewise minimizes your canine’s general tension level and prevents monotony. Ask your vet to advise toxin-free rawhide, nylon and rubber chew toys.




Tips on Eye Care for Pet Owners in Moncton NB

Did you know that you can supply frequent eye care for your pet in the house? Routine house eye exams will ensure you’re aware of any eye tearing, cloudiness, inflammation, and health issues.

First, get your canine to sit and face a brightly lit area when analyzing their eyes. If healthy, they should be lit and clear, and the surrounding area to the eyeball should be white. The pupils need to be equally sized and there should not be any signs of tearing, crust, or discharge on the corners of their eyes.

To remove any substance in their eyes, use a gentle clean and a damp cotton ball. Cautiously clean in the external direction from the corner of their eyes and ensure you do not touch their eye itself. Its best you pursue medical attention from your local Moncton vet as they may have an infection if your family pet regularly has runny eyes caused from discharge.

Ear Care for Canines Who Swim

Canines that have frequent baths or go swimming a lot can be more prone to ear irritation and infection. To prevent infection, put cotton inside your pet dog’s ears before baths or swimming and make sure to dry their ears out thoroughly as soon as they’re done.




Tips on Nail Care for Pet Parents in Moncton NB

As a common rule of thumb, your pets nail must only be trimmed when they are close to touching the ground when they walk. Or if your pet dog’s nails click or snag the floor, they need to be cut.

Preventing Paw Problems in Pet Dogs

When beginning a brand-new workout regimen with your fur baby, start it gradually. Their paws can quickly end up being sensitive or broken, particularly with long hikes or runs. Ensure your yard and house are clear from any dangers and also avoid dangers like debris and broken glass when out for walks. Last but not least, always remember this easy pointer – if you wouldn’t want to stroll barefoot on it, neither will your fur baby!
